- 博客(72)
- 资源 (16)
- 问答 (1)
- 收藏
- 关注

原创 由大学到至今的小作品(不定时更新)
1. 记事本(大二上学期)描述:用于练习java,使用了substanceUI类库,同时添加了许多系统txt工具没有的功能,例如文字颜色的改变,字体大小,粗体斜体等,同时加入高大上的中英切换,以及人性化的夜间模式截图:1. java聊天系统(大二下学期)描述:局域网内在线多人聊天系统技术:c/s模式,sql数据库,界面美化截图:
2014-11-26 20:15:36
817
原创 Fragment记录
1.Fragment源码分析http://blog.youkuaiyun.com/jy03773322/article/details/8025908http://blog.youkuaiyun.com/jy03773322/article/details/8048045http://blog.youkuaiyun.com/jy03773322/article/details/80458052.F
2015-04-14 11:26:15
783
转载 关于Fragment使用中遇到的异常:Fragment already added和fragment not attached&
转自:http://blog.sina.com.cn/s/blog_5da93c8f0102v042.html问题1:java.lang.IllegalStateException: Fragment already added异常的处理。当快速双击调用FragmentTransaction.add()方法添加fragmentA,而fragmentA不是每次单独生成的,
2015-04-14 10:54:32
8539
原创 Android系统记录
1. android 系统签名1)在源码build\target\product\security中找到platform.x509.pem platform.pk82)在build\tools\signapk找到signapk.java编译成signapk.jar或者下载 http://download.youkuaiyun.com/detail/suchto/4528837 3)java -
2015-04-03 14:42:29
726
转载 Android 之 设置EditText最大可输入字符
转自:http://blog.youkuaiyun.com/liujianminghero/article/details/7092236Android 中的EditText最大可输入字符数可以通过xml文件中为EditText设置maxLength属性或者在代码中为EditText设置LengthFilter来设置。例如要设置EditText只能输入10个字符xml中:
2015-03-16 09:53:58
871
原创 RadioButton记录
1. Android RadioButton 语言切换问题转自:http://blog.youkuaiyun.com/wangjia55/article/details/22808753偶然间发现在不退出界面的情况下,RadioButton在语言切换时会出现不同步的问题:本来整个界面是英文的,这时如果把语言切换成中文,则会出现界面是其它的部分都已经正常的加载了,但是RadioButton部分
2015-03-11 16:50:01
643
原创 Launcher记录
1. Android widget 桌面组件开发http://www.cnblogs.com/playing/archive/2011/04/12/2013386.html
2015-03-10 10:02:21
562
原创 BroadcasetReceiver记录
1. LocalBroadcastManager在android-support-v4.jar中引入了LocalBroadcastManager,称为局部通知管理器,这种通知的好处是安全性高,效率也高,适合局部通信http://my.oschina.net/ososchina/blog/340339
2015-03-03 16:17:49
572
原创 Activity记录
1. Activity的Launch mode详解 singleTask正解http://www.cnblogs.com/xiaoQLu/archive/2011/09/29/2195742.html2. Android Intent.FLAG_NEW_TASK详解,包括其他的标记的一些解释http://www.cnblogs.com/xiaoQLu
2015-02-12 09:40:38
1096
原创 Button记录
1. 屏蔽按键声android:soundEffectsEnabled="false"button.setSoundEffectsEnabled(false);
2015-02-03 19:07:36
679
原创 Asynctask使用记录
1. 取消,停止转自:http://blog.youkuaiyun.com/icyfox_bupt/article/details/13044217我的程序中,使用了AsyncTask在后台进行持续的轮询,实现一个定时器的功能,在doInBackground()有Thread.sleep()的代码其原理是一个Service获得了通知以后就关掉Asynctask,但是[j
2015-01-30 21:34:40
638
原创 android单位
1. setTextsetTextSize(TypedValue.COMPLEX_UNIT_PX,22); //22像素 setTextSize(TypedValue.COMPLEX_UNIT_SP,22); //22SP setTextSize(TypedValue.COMPLEX_UNIT_DIP,22);//22DIP 如果22为22sp,则改2
2015-01-28 10:40:50
658
转载 通过代码setTextColor,改变不同状态下的textColor
转自:http://dwtedx.com/itshare_222.html通过代码setTextColor时、如果color是一个资源文件 会set失败 没有效果遇到这样的情况有两种解决办法、亲测过、两种都是有效的一、注解方式通过在方法上面添加注解解决问题代码如下@SuppressLint("ResourceAsColor")
2015-01-23 15:11:13
1141
原创 键盘显示隐藏控制
1. 点击空白处隐藏键盘:在activity中:private InputMethodManager manager ;manager = (InputMethodManager)getSystemService(Context.INPUT_METHOD_SERVICE);/** * Click on the blank space to hide the keyboard
2015-01-10 16:56:03
636
原创 Listview记录
public void setListViewHeight(ListView listView, Adapter adapter) { if(adapter == null) { return; } int totalHeight = 0; for (int i = 0; i < adapter.getCou
2015-01-09 20:16:57
623
原创 LoaderManager.LoaderCallbacks的使用
文章为最简单使用记录笔记1. 作用实现异步查询 , 提供了回调机制onLoadFinished()通知最终的运行结果 , 实现Cursor监听,当改变的时候,进行查询,结果在onLoadFinished()中显示2.使用 a) 继承 implements View.OnClickListener ,
2015-01-05 16:57:35
912
原创 EditText记录
import android.content.Context;import android.graphics.drawable.Drawable;import android.text.Editable;import android.text.TextWatcher;import android.util.AttributeSet;import android.view.MotionEv
2015-01-03 10:13:20
731
原创 ListView中控件添加Listener的优化
借鉴文档:http://blog.youkuaiyun.com/yangzl2008/article/details/7863938本文是借鉴网友Snowball的ListView中含有Button时setOnclickListener应写在Adapter的什么地方>>文章,再进行整理和添加自己的想法我们知道,listview中经常需要用到自定义的布局,并为布局中的控件添加监听器
2014-12-25 16:19:57
1127
原创 RecyclerView使用:深入 CursorAdapter(3)
问题在使用listview的时候,如果数据源来自数据库,我们可能会使用到cursorAdapterlistiew.setAdapter(cursorAdapter) 是常见的用法但是,当我们使用RecyclerView的时候,Adapter为cursorAdapter是会报错的。到目前为止,RecyclerView是不支持cursorAdapter的,但在github上有网友通过改
2014-12-25 11:26:09
5814
转载 RecyclerView使用:深入 onItemClick(2)
借鉴资料:http://blog.youkuaiyun.com/jwzhangjie/article/details/36868515http://stackoverflow.com/questions/24471109/recyclerview-onclick/26196831#26196831在Adapter中: public interface O
2014-12-25 10:58:58
1303
转载 RecyclerView使用:初步(1)
转自:http://chuansongme.com/n/510236RecyclerView 是 android-support-v7-21 版本中新增的一个 Widgets, 还有一个 CardView 会在下次介绍使用。官方介绍 RecyclerView 是 ListView 的升级版本,更加先进和灵活。我们写一个简单的实例例,来看一下究竟有多先进和灵活。开发环境
2014-12-25 10:32:36
1064
原创 CursorAdapter使用
1. Adapter的关系图 2. CursorAdapter构造函数public CursorAdapter (Context context, Cursor c)Api11开始被弃用public CursorAdapter (Context context, Cursor c, boolean autoRequery)autoeque
2014-12-24 14:33:00
1150
转载 SQLite 模糊查询
转自:http://blog.sina.com.cn/s/blog_5da93c8f0100tdha.html使用SQLite数据库执行模糊查询实现:(1)使用db.query方法查询// select * from users where name like %searcherFilter% ; public List> queryByLike(String s
2014-12-23 19:10:36
1043
原创 Fragment,Activity切换动画--Demo
原作者:http://www.cnblogs.com/mengdd/p/3494041.html代码:demo.jar1. Fragment切换动画可以借鉴例子代码 com.emngdd.transaction.fragment.hight.TestFragmentActivity中 addFragment() 的注释代码对应运行的dem
2014-12-23 15:30:35
777
原创 Android Title设置
1. 只去图标4.0以后,actionbar来控制标题栏的显示。比如getActionBar.setDisplayShowHomeEnabled(false)应该可以去掉图标2. 去标题requestWindowFeature(Window.FEATURE_NO_TITLE);
2014-12-23 14:35:19
825
原创 Ubuntu下安装android studio
各种资源可以在下面下载http://blog.youkuaiyun.com/qqgrid/article/details/420030411.下载jdkhttp://blog.youkuaiyun.com/qqgrid/article/details/41986433注意:android studio需要至少jdk1.7及以上2.下载android studio , sdk
2014-12-18 14:08:25
858
原创 分享一个下载sdk,android studio ,Eclipse , jdk ,adt网站
http://tools.android-studio.org/
2014-12-18 11:19:55
821
原创 Ubuntu下编译android源码
1.准备 1)jdk已经安装好对应版本(jdk 1.6) 2)已经通过git+repo下载好源码2.配置 2.1 下载必要到软件(如果出现问题,可以用下面的方法)$ sudo apt-get install git gnupg flex bison gperf build-essential \ zip curl
2014-12-18 09:07:08
908
原创 Ubuntu下安装jdk,修改jdk
1.下载jdkjdk合集:http://www.oracle.com/technetwork/java/javase/downloads/index.html1.6: http://www.oracle.com/technetwork/java/javasebusiness/downloads/java-archive-downloads-javase6-419409.html#jdk
2014-12-17 20:12:31
1196
原创 开启本地服务器,利用二维码进行通信[Demo]
开启本地服务器,扫描二维码进行通信前言:之前写过一个通过socket通信的软件,实现pc与android互相传送文件,android控制pc等等功能。现在想做一个使用http通信的(纯粹无聊),优点是不需要下载android客户端,并且希望能在ios端也可以使用(当然有待改进)。手机通过扫描产生的二维码来访问pc的客户端,再进行通信。现在只处于demo阶段,后面有空陆续上传完整版。
2014-12-12 10:20:25
2869
转载 android实现文本复制到剪切板功能(ClipboardManager)
转自:http://www.jb51.net/article/47128.htmAndroid也有剪切板(ClipboardManager),可以复制一些有用的文本到剪贴板,以便用户可以粘贴的地方使用,下面是使用方法注意:导包的时候API 11之前: android.text.ClipboardManagerAPI 11之后: android.con
2014-12-09 13:06:18
9559
转载 setClickable(false)不起作用
转自:http://blog.youkuaiyun.com/datao819/article/details/7641267问题:设置一个控件的setClickable(false)后,发现没有效果。解决办法:setClickable(false)方法一定要在setOnClickListener()方法之后。因为在setOnClickListener()方法
2014-12-05 14:49:29
1003
转载 Android HttpClient,httpPost基本使用方法
转自:http://chunpeng.iteye.com/blog/631972Android通过http协议POST传输方式如下:方式一:HttpPost(import org.apache.http.client.methods.HttpPost)代码如下:private Button button1,button2,button3;pr
2014-12-05 13:18:46
1327
原创 XListView-Android-master添加startRefresh方法
在已有的XListView-Android-master代码中添加调用刷新的方法,主要用于自由调用刷新事件,不需要下拉触发,例如间隔事件去刷新XListView-Android-master下载:http://download.youkuaiyun.com/download/qqgrid/8223833在XListView.java中添加,调用startRe
2014-12-04 13:11:26
887
原创 解决WebView实现获得js中Function返回值
整理自:http://blog.sina.com.cn/s/blog_67ac56e70101ajlp.html本文实现的是使用WebView调用js代码,并获得function的return值1. 创建自定义的 MyWebView 并继承 WebView public class MyWebView extends WebView {
2014-11-30 16:45:46
4096
Fragment,Activity切换动画demo
2014-12-23
swing-worker-1.1.jar
2014-12-09
addJavaScriptInterface使用demo
2014-11-30
设置intent跳转的默认应用
2015-05-14
TA创建的收藏夹 TA关注的收藏夹
TA关注的人